Output 681959c396b982fa48b821346de0eda2cf9f8191d1679c0e3ecbf5ce19f6ad01:2

value
134661792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8fd2e6d926ac7e1c7f1f0ed6e157744e65ec6c2 OP_EQUAL
address
MPJh41MdWwkcpLqicUGu2sZpGxxLfk4smw
transaction
681959c396b982fa48b821346de0eda2cf9f8191d1679c0e3ecbf5ce19f6ad01
spent
true